Book Review: The Candy Cane Man

 

A renowned candy factory. A deadly accident. An unforgivable cover-up.

Paul and Lee aren't sure they believe the story of Geneva Grove's legendary Candy Cane Man, but when they find themselves trapped in the abandoned ghost town during a raging blizzard, they soon realize they're not alone, and their night of terror is only just beginning.


My Review

Paul and Lee have traveled back to Paul's hometown. What was supposed to be a quick trip to check on Paul's childhood home, turns out to be a nightmare that both will not forget. Only one will survive the night. 


I liked this short story. That was a good balance of the build up without drawing it out too much. The Candy Cane Man is something made of nightmares. I would not want to encounter him. After reading this story, I do want to check out more books by the author. Don't choke on your candy cane!
